How to Set a Fire and Why
Jesse Ball
Lucia Stanton's father is dead, her mother is in a mental hospital, and she's recently been kicked out of school-again. Living with her aunt in a garage-turned-bedroom, and armed with only a book, a Zippo lighter, and a pocketful of stolen licorice, she spends her days riding the bus to visit her mom and following the only rule that makes any sense: Don't do things you aren't proud of.
